2.12 Gamma Shift Adjustment

[PC-gamma off adjustment]
1. Receive the 16-step gray scale computer signal.
2. Set to COMPUTER mode.
3. Enter the service mode, select item no. "6" of group no. "2" and change data value to
adjust it so that the gray scale screen appears correctly on the screen.
[AV-gamma off adjustment]
4. Receive the 16-step gray scale video signal.
5. Set to VIDEO mode.
6. Enter the service mode, select item no. "6" of group no. "2" and change data value to
adjust it so that the gray scale screen appears correctly on the screen.

2.13 White Balance Adjustment

[PC white balance adjustment]
1. Receive the 16-step gray scale computer signal.
2. Set to COMPUTER mode.
3. Enter the service mode, select item no. "7" (Red) or "8" (Blue) of group no. "2", and
change data values respectively to make a proper white balance.
4. Perform step 3 with the BRIGHT button ON and OFF.
[AV white adjustment]
5. Receive the 16-step gray scale video signal.
6. Set to VIDEO mode.
7. Enter the service mode, select item no. "7" (Red) or "8" (Blue) of group no. "2", and
change data values respectively to make a proper white balance.
8. Perform step 7 with the BRIGHT button ON and OFF.
* Verify that the white balance for video input is equal to that for computer input.

2.14 Note on White Uniformity Adjustment

If you find the color shading on the screen, adjust the white uniformity by using the
proper computer and "Color Shading Correction" software.
The software is supplied with this service manual.
